Roses Run Country Club
About
Roses Run Country Club is touted as being northeast Ohio's toughest public golf course. The course has an interesting mix of holes from lengthy par 4s to tough par 3s and reachable par 5s. The front nine is a traditional links layout while the back nine hugs the Cuyahoga River with winding fairways that melt into fast, sloping greens. The layout incorporates a variety of elevation changes ranging from subtle to dramatic. There are also water hazards and strategically placed bunkers coming into play throughout. Roses Run Country Club will require some creative shot-making and the use of every club in your bag. It's a formidable layout that will test even the most skilled players. There is a driving range and practice putting green you can use for warming up, which might be a good idea before taking on this tough course.
|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Gold | 72 | 6859 yards | 73.3 | 128 |
| Blue | 72 | 6527 yards | 71.5 | 122 |
| White | 72 | 6104 yards | 69.5 | 119 |
| Red (W) | 72 | 4964 yards | 69.3 | 116 |

Quirky Layout and Quirky Greens
The course is interesting and challenging. But parts of it are downright quirky. For example, the Par 5 fifth hole is 350 yards. I teed off with a 9 iron to keep in front of the lake. Hit 2 good shots to get right in front of the green, only to find out the there was no way to keep my chip shot anywhere close to the pin because it was tucked in the extreme right corner of the green. It seemed like the greenskeeper had a bad day. A number of the pins were not easily accessible at all.
Pace of play was a problem too. The front nine was almost 3 hours. We never saw a ranger. We quit after 11 holes and 3.5 hours of our time. We couldn’t take it anymore.
